Fan Reaction: Mixed Views on Daredevil Reboot

Fans sound off on new Daredevil remake

Fox recently hired  The Day the Earth Stood Still writer David Scarpa to begin work on the reboot of the blind Marvel superhero Daredevil. Here are some fan reactions from around the Internet.
